सांस्कृतिक पृष्ठभूमि
The concept of 'Jeong' (정) means that Koreans are often very willing to help, especially if you use polite language. Don't be surprised if someone goes out of their way to walk you to your destination. In a Korean office, asking for help is seen as a sign of being a 'team player' rather than a sign of weakness, as long as you use the correct honorifics. On platforms like Twitter or Naver, people use '#도와주세요' (Please help) for everything from finding lost pets to technical PC issues. Historically, 'Pumasi' was the exchange of labor. This phrase is the modern linguistic descendant of that communal spirit.

Add '혹시'
Starting with '혹시' (hok-si) makes you sound 10x more polite and natural.
Object Markers
Don't forget '을/를' after the task you need help with.
The 'Giving' Nuance
Remember that '주다' implies you are receiving a favor. Be ready to say '감사합니다'!
Informal Version
Just drop the '요' to say '도와줄 수 있어?' to friends.
